Summary:
Need more robust way to recover if BIRCH download fails
|
Original submission:
If a BIRCH download fails during an update, you are left with missing BIRCH directories, because getbirch refuses to try to install if a partial copy of BIRCH exists. This happens because the first thing we do before downloading is to run UNINSTALL-birch.py.
This would probably also be a problem if we were doing a new install.
We need to rethink how getbirch determines what to do if a previous install attempt has failed.

Several fixes:
1. Getbirch now runs UNINSTALL-birch within the download method, after downloading and before untarring.
2. UNINSTALL-birch.py now has a -d <dirname> option that is called to ensure that it finds the copy of BIRCH that needs to be deleted.
3. To make UNINSTALL-birch independent of whether or not the rest of BIRCH is present, code from various Python modules in birchlib have been hard-coded into UNINSTALL-birch.py, making it a standalone script.
4. If there is not a copy of UNINSTALL-birch.py, getbirch downloads a copy so it can do the uninstall.

Decision: Let's run UNINSTALL-birch AFTER the downloads are complete. The only advantage to running before is that it saves disk space, and we can usually assume that most systems today will have enough extra disk space.

Install: Don't need to worry about install. Getbirch gives the framework and bin files unique names each time a download is done. These are Java temporary files, meaning that JVM automatically deletes them when done. So a failed download during a new install should not leave behind a partial version of BIRCH.
